1. Proven Experience in Complex Equipment Manufacturing
One of the first questions you should ask is simply: “Have they done work like this before?”
High‑complexity systems are not the same as commodity parts. They involve:
- Tight tolerances and precision machined components
- Multi‑discipline assembly techniques
- Integrated controls, sensors, or motion systems
- Custom test or inspection processes
Look for manufacturers with a track record of delivering complex builds with documented quality outcomes. Ask for case studies, reference projects, or examples where they successfully executed builds similar in scope, even if the project or industry differs from yours.
Key evaluation questions:
✔ What types of complex assemblies have you built?
✔ Can you share examples of similar builds?
✔ What tolerances and precision requirements have you successfully met?
2. Engineering Collaboration and Documentation Control
For high‑complexity builds, engineering coordination is non‑negotiable. A qualified contract manufacturer should:
- Review and provide feedback on customer CAD models and drawings
- Identify potential manufacturability challenges early
- Maintain rigorous revision control
- Help ensure alignment between design intent and manufacturing execution
Contract manufacturers with strong documentation practices reduce risk by ensuring everyone – engineering, quality, fabrication, and assembly – works from the same, current revision of documentation.
Best practices include:
✔ Establishment of a project team including a project manager as well as communication protocols and frequency
✔ Integrated change control (ECO/ECN) processes
✔ Clear as‑built documentation and traceability
3. Quality Systems and Certifications
When you’re building complex products, quality can’t be an afterthought, it must be woven into every step of the manufacturing process.
Make sure your contract manufacturing partner has:
- A formal Quality Management System (QMS), such as ISO 9001
- Procedures supporting first article inspection and control plans
- Traceability for materials, welds, and critical components
- Experience with customer audits and documented process control
In high‑complexity builds, adherence to quality standards strengthens consistency and reduces risk over long production lifecycles.
4. Production Capability and Technological Investment
Capabilities matter, especially when parts require precision machining, micro‑tolerances, or complex assemblies. When evaluating potential partners, verify that they have:
- Advanced CNC machines (including 5‑axis where required)
- Automated welding systems and fixturing for repeatable results
- In‑house inspection equipment and processes
- ERP system for integrated business systems management
Investments in the right tools and technology demonstrate a manufacturer’s commitment to quality and future readiness.
5. Supply Chain Resilience
Complex builds often have long BOMs, diverse components, and an extensive list of external suppliers. Ask how your contract manufacturer manages:
- Lead times for critical components
- Approved vendor lists (AVLs)
- Alternate sourcing for long‑lead items
- Risk mitigation for supply chain disruptions
A resilient partner will help you plan for uncertainties, proactively identify substitute components, and protect your schedule.
6. Communication, Project Management & Transparency
Clear communication is crucial for any project, especially as complexity increases. Your manufacturing partner should provide:
- A single point of contact or project manager
- Regular updates and milestone reporting
- Visibility into production status, quality results, and schedule risks
- Collaborative problem‑solving when issues arise
Companies that excel at communication reduce ambiguity and provide confidence, even when projects hit technical challenges.
7. Facility, Safety, and Cultural Fit
Lastly, visit their facility if possible, or request a virtual tour. Look for:
- Clean, organized workspaces
- Safety protocols and training programs
- Evidence of continuous improvement
- A culture that values accountability and craftsmanship
A manufacturing partner’s physical environment often reflects their discipline and attention to detail.
